How to Calculate Calories Burned Using Your Heart Rate

While most cardio machines estimate calorie burn based on general intensity levels, using your heart rate provides a much more personalized and accurate window into your actual energy expenditure. Heart rate is a direct indicator of how hard your cardiovascular system is working to deliver oxygen to your muscles.

The Science: Why Heart Rate Matters

Oxygen consumption (VO2) and heart rate have a linear relationship during moderate to high-intensity exercise. As your heart beats faster, your body is consuming more oxygen to fuel the chemical reactions that produce energy (ATP). This calculator uses a scientifically validated formula derived from the Journal of Sports Sciences, which accounts for your age, weight, and biological sex to refine the estimation.

How to Get Accurate Results

To ensure the best data from this calculator, follow these tips:

  • Use a Chest Strap: Optical sensors (like wristwatches) can be less accurate during high-intensity movements. A chest strap monitors electrical activity directly from the heart.
  • Calculate Average HR: Do not use your peak heart rate. Use the "average" heart rate provided by your fitness tracker at the end of the session.
  • Monitor Intensity: This formula is most accurate when your heart rate is between 90 BPM and 150 BPM. At extremely high or low intensities, the relationship between heart rate and oxygen consumption can become non-linear.

Factors That Influence Calorie Burn

It is important to remember that variables like ambient temperature, hydration levels, caffeine intake, and even your current stress levels can elevate your heart rate without necessarily increasing the number of calories burned by a significant margin. However, for consistent training tracking, heart rate monitoring remains one of the gold standards for fitness enthusiasts.
